Output 39407089937ea8dde3e202a57045ba83c59aec82ceaf56295cffacae4d049fbf:0

value
11167596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08e58ed2543fa850de6675fc9bfe298b9f62f4b7 OP_EQUAL
address
32W4L3K9NjZSF3drdPKpmzBPWzAninJHkH
transaction
39407089937ea8dde3e202a57045ba83c59aec82ceaf56295cffacae4d049fbf
spent
true